  • Fireproof sealing hole dimensions for cable trays

    Fireproof sealing hole dimensions for cable trays

    The gap area between firestop packs and cables should not exceed 1 cm2, and the packing thickness should be not less than 24 cm. * Two (2) sticks of moldable putty (part number FSP-MPS) are also needed for each opening. UL Listed Systems Concrete Wall - C-AJ-4056 3 HR F-Rating, 3/4 HR T-Rating Gypsum. Firestop packs should be placed in an orderly sequence. rs seals for single cables or pipes.     Can cable trays be used to store wires

    Cable trays are support systems designed to securely hold and protect various types of cables and wires. They come in various materials such as steel, aluminium, and fiberglass, each catering to specific application requirements. Cable trays come in different types: Materials: They can be metal (like steel with a coating, or stainless steel), plastic (like. A cable tray system is a structured assembly used to support and organize insulated electrical cables for power distribution, communication, and control signals. By. cal devices or other equipment.
